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ost in Bentonville, AR
The cost of sewer backup water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Bentonville, AR. Our team will prov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call us today for a free estimate!
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age. |
| Cleaning and dis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ning solution used. |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ed to repair the area. |
| Equipment rental and usage | $100 – $500 | The type of equipment used and the duration of the rental. |
| Disposal fees | $50 – $200 | The type and quantity of materials disposed of. |

Q: How do I prevent sewer backups in the future?
A: To prevent sewer backups, it’s essential to maintain your pipes and drains regularly. You should also avoid flushing items that can cause clogs, such as sanitary products and paper towels. Our team can provide you with more information on how to maintain your pipes and prevent sewer backups.
